What You'll Do
Lead complex software projects from first scope to delivery, working with the customer and a multidisciplinary team the whole way. In practice that means:
- Lead distributed international development and testing teams, motivating them across time zones and borders.
- Build trusted relationships with customers and act as their delivery partner, negotiating scope and change requests on equal footing and protecting our commercial interests when the situation becomes tense.
- Plan and steer with both classical and agile methods, knowing when each fits.
- Own budget, schedule, risk, dependencies, and project profitability. Prioritize, delegate, and seek help when the load becomes too high.
- Understand engineering well enough to hold a technical conversation and to know how a business application gets built from scratch, even though you do not need to write code.
What We're Looking For
We expect you to run recurring project work AI‑first and make the method reusable, so the capability benefits not just you but your entire team. You should be able to:
- Run status reports, delivery roadmaps, and KPI analysis AI‑first, generated from your project data rather than assembled by hand.
- Delegate defined steps to AI agents and verify their output at critical points.
- Understand the AI‑first SDLC: how to initiate and run a project AI‑first, how to move a team from traditional to AI‑first delivery, and how the roles around you shift during that transition.
- Handle customer‑side AI constraints with judgment—including public versus sensitive data, on‑premise versus cloud, and situations where a customer prohibits AI—and explain calmly how our licensed tools align with their policies and legal requirements.
- Have extensive experience leading software development projects and distributed international teams.
- Be comfortable working directly with customers, building enduring relationships.
- Make data‑driven decisions; at Nortal numbers are a daily habit, not a quarterly event.
- Communicate precisely, reliably, and professionally in written form.
- Negotiate and communicate confidently in German (C1) and work in English daily; be prepared to travel occasionally for customer meetings and team gatherings.
